微信,作为中国最流行的即时通讯应用,其背后有着庞大的运维服务商团队。这些服务商不仅提供日常的运维支持,还负责技术保障,确保微信的稳定运行。本文将深入解析微信运维服务商的技术保障,帮助读者了解其背后的工作原理,从而更好地应对运营挑战。
一、微信运维服务商概述
微信运维服务商主要负责以下几个方面的工作:
- 系统监控:实时监控系统运行状态,确保系统稳定可靠。
- 故障处理:在系统出现故障时,迅速定位问题并进行修复。
- 性能优化:不断优化系统性能,提升用户体验。
- 安全防护:保障用户数据安全,防止恶意攻击。
- 容量规划:根据用户增长情况,合理规划系统容量。
二、技术保障解析
1. 系统监控
微信运维服务商采用多种监控手段,确保系统稳定运行。以下是一些常见的监控技术:
- 日志分析:通过分析系统日志,发现潜在问题。
- 性能监控:实时监控CPU、内存、磁盘等资源使用情况。
- 网络监控:监控网络流量,发现网络瓶颈。
- 应用监控:监控应用运行状态,确保应用稳定。
2. 故障处理
在系统出现故障时,微信运维服务商会迅速响应,采取以下措施:
- 故障定位:通过监控数据、日志分析等手段,快速定位故障原因。
- 故障修复:根据故障原因,采取相应措施进行修复。
- 故障回滚:在修复过程中,确保不影响用户体验。
3. 性能优化
微信运维服务商通过以下手段进行性能优化:
- 代码优化:优化代码,提高系统运行效率。
- 数据库优化:优化数据库结构,提高查询速度。
- 缓存策略:合理配置缓存,减少数据库访问次数。
4. 安全防护
微信运维服务商采取以下措施保障用户数据安全:
- 数据加密:对用户数据进行加密存储,防止数据泄露。
- 访问控制:严格控制访问权限,防止非法访问。
- 入侵检测:实时监控系统,发现并阻止恶意攻击。
5. 容量规划
微信运维服务商根据用户增长情况,合理规划系统容量,以下是一些常见策略:
- 横向扩展:增加服务器数量,提高系统处理能力。
- 纵向扩展:升级服务器硬件,提高系统性能。
- 负载均衡:合理分配请求,避免单点过载。
三、应对运营挑战
了解微信运维服务商的技术保障,有助于我们更好地应对运营挑战。以下是一些建议:
- 加强监控:实时监控系统运行状态,及时发现并解决问题。
- 优化性能:不断优化系统性能,提升用户体验。
- 提升安全意识:加强安全防护,保障用户数据安全。
- 合理规划容量:根据用户增长情况,合理规划系统容量。
总之,微信运维服务商在技术保障方面发挥着重要作用。了解其工作原理,有助于我们更好地应对运营挑战,确保微信的稳定运行。
